variety[və’raiəti]n. 品种,种类;多样化
1705097483
1705097484
例句 1. We all have received a variety of presents, but some of them may make us recall the nice memories. 我们每个人都收到过各种各样的礼物,而其中的一些礼物能让我们想起美好的回忆。
1705097485
1705097486
2. I prefer television programs that contain an enormous variety of forms and content. 我喜欢那些形式和内容丰富的电视节目。
1705097487
1705097488
要点 形容词various也可以表达“多种多样的”,意思和用法相当于a variety of。

托福写作1000词 文体娱乐篇
1705097505
1705097506
addict[‘ædikt]n. 有瘾的人,入迷的人[ə’dikt]v. 使成瘾,使入迷
1705097507
1705097508
例句 1. We are so addicted to all of what they said that we are not able to think on our own. 我们太沉溺于他们的说法,以至于无法按照自己的意愿思考。
1705097509
1705097510
2. I can’t deny that some people have ignored their friends and family while they are addicted into watching TV. 我无法否认的是一些人沉溺于电视节目,而忽略了朋友和家人。
1705097511
1705097512
3. There are many medical reports warning people that depending on fast food is unhealthy, and there is a high prevalence of malnutrition among those who are addicted to burgers and cola. 许多医学报告都警告人们依赖快餐是不健康的,而且在那些对汉堡和可乐上瘾的人们中,营养失调症的情况十分常见。
1705097513
1705097514
派生 addictive(a. 使人上瘾的);addiction(n. 上瘾,沉溺)
